While both Home Page stress washing and power washing usage high-pressure streams of water to scrub challenging surfaces, power washing uses warm water, and stress cleaning uses cozy or cool water. This set trick distinction means that stress washing is better for some cleansing applications, while power washing is better for others.


About Power Washing


It's difficult to state whether pressure cleaning or power washing is much better, due to the fact that each solution is best at particular tasks. To generalise, stress cleaning is gentler and much better for softer surfaces such as wooden decks, plastic home exteriors, and asphalt tile roof. Power cleaning is extreme and can be harmful, and is best for the hardest surfaces, like concrete and brick.

The warm water used while power washing makes it appropriate for killing mold and mildew and plant growth in the structures being cleansed. The heat also aids get rid of more grease and adhesives and leaves why not check here you with a cleaner last surface. It is necessary to stay clear of having actually power cleaning done often, even on difficult concrete surface areas, due to the fact that this cleaning technique can remove away the exterior finishing and might compel you to buy concrete repairs and resurfacing.




Quotes are established in the same way for both services, but pressure washing is a bit more inexpensive at $0.20 to $1.00 usually, while power cleaning prices in between $0.75 to $1.50 per square foot.
